Southampton moved above Manchester United and into third in the league as Dusan Tadic’s second-half goal settled a game of few chances at Old Trafford yesterday.Louis van Gaal’s side failed to have a single shot on target as their 10-match unbeaten run in the league was ended.
Tadic scored the only goal of the game when he tapped in calmly from 12 yards after Graziano Pelle’s effort had come back off the far post.
The Reds improved after the goal but Juan Mata missed two good chances.

In an earlier game, a sublime Alexis Sanchez scored twice and created a third as Arsenal climbed level on points with fourth-placed Southampton following a 3-0 Premier League victory against Stoke City.
After Laurent Koscielny headed Arsenal into a sixth-minute lead from a Sanchez cross the outstanding Chilean fired in a brilliant second before scoring with a deflected freekick for his 18th goal in all competitions this season.
Arsenal’s win was soured somewhat by a serious looking injury to defender Mathieu Debuchy but the Gunners were able to welcome back German World Cup-winner Mesut Ozil following a lengthy injury absence.
Victory lifted Arsenal above rivals Tottenham Hotspur to fifth on the Premier League table. — BBC
